What Are Piston Coatings?

Piston coatings are specialized layers applied to the surface of engine pistons. They serve to protect the piston from extreme conditions within the combustion chamber. Common types include ceramic coatings, thermal barrier coatings, and dry film lubricants. Each type offers unique benefits tailored to different engine needs.

Benefits of Piston Coatings for Nashville Engines

  • Enhanced Heat Resistance: Coatings help pistons withstand higher temperatures, reducing the risk of engine knocking and pre-ignition.
  • Reduced Friction: Smoother piston surfaces decrease internal friction, leading to increased power output and fuel efficiency.
  • Improved Durability: Coated pistons are more resistant to wear and corrosion, extending engine lifespan.
  • Better Tuning Performance: Maintaining optimal piston temperatures and minimizing friction allows for more aggressive tuning without risking engine damage.
